REPORT
For the 2024 Board of Retirement election, the General Member Seat No. 2 is vacant for election.
Alysia Bonner was unopposed at the close of nominations for the 2024 Board of Retirement election as General Member Seat No. 2 on the Board of Retirement.
As provided by the Elections Procedures, upon your Board receiving the accompanying certification of the Retirement Administrator, Ms. Bonner must be seated by your Board ordering that no election be held and directing the Clerk of the Board of Supervisors to undertake the recommended actions, and by her thereafter being sworn in by the Board of Retirement.

DISCUSSION:
In accordance with Government Code § 31520.1, the Board of Supervisors established elections procedures for the Board of Retirement election process (“Election Procedures”). The Election Procedures were adopted on November 25, 1969 and amended on October 30, 2001, March 1, 2005, September 11, 2007, August 11, 2009, December 8, 2015, June 18, 2019, and again on June 22, 2021 and state the following:
“If any duly nominated and eligible candidate is unopposed for election at the close of nominations, the Retirement Administrator shall so certify to the Board of Supervisors, and the Board of Supervisors shall order that no election be held for such seat and shall direct the Clerk of the Board of Supervisors to cast a unanimous ballot in favor of the candidate pursuant to Government Code § 31523, subdivision I. The Clerk of the Board of Supervisors shall deliver the casted ballot to the Board of Retirement, and a copy thereof to the County Registrar of Voters.” (Sec. IV.H., p. 22)
Accordingly, Government Code § 31523 provides:
“(c) If an election has been called on the expiration of the term of office of any member… for the second… member of a board of retirement, and only one candidate has been duly nominated in accordance with the rules established for the holding of that election, the board of supervisors shall order that no election be held and shall direct the clerk to cast a unanimous ballot in favor of the candidate.”
On May 15, 2024, as Retirement Administrator for FCERA, under the Election Procedures, I provided or caused to be provided appropriate and timely notice that an active member election will be held on August 15, 2024, for General Member Seat No. 2 for the Board of Retirement. As the Retirement Administrator for FCERA, I have determined that Alysia Bonner, as a duly nominated and eligible candidate for the 2024 Board of Retirement Election, for General Member Seat No. 2, was unopposed at the close of nominations under the Board of Supervisors elections procedures for Board of Retirement elections.
I provide a certification to your Board of the foregoing facts, which certification accompanies this agenda item.
In addition, on July 17, 2024, the Board of Retirement, by unanimous approval, and without any public opposition during the relevant public comment portion of their agenda, certified that Alysia Bonner was duly nominated and unopposed for election to General Member Seat No. 2 on the Board of Retirement, and directed its Staff to place the certification on your Board’s agenda.
Pursuant to the Election Procedures and California law, your Board is requested to order that no general member election be held, and to direct the Clerk of your Board to cast a unanimous ballot in favor of Alysia Bonner, for General Member Seat No. 2 on the Board of Retirement and to deliver such cast ballot to the Board of Retirement and a copy thereof to FCERA and the Fresno County Clerk/Registrar of Voters.
The official ballot for the Clerk of the Board to cast, upon your Board’s direction, is on file with her Office, and a copy of such official ballot accompanies this agenda item.
Once the foregoing recommended actions, above, are completed, and Ms. Bonner is sworn in by the Board of Retirement, her term will commence January 1, 2025 and expire December 31, 2027.
Ms. Bonner currently serves on General Member Seat No. 2 on the Board of Retirement, as an unopposed candidate for the 2021 election of that seat.
